It is commonly served in a special glass, thicker than usual to avoid thermal collapse of it, and whose design is inspired by the one manufactured at the

ancient Glass
Factory of St. Lucia in Cartagena. This new glass replaced the glass of vermouth that was originally used because of its greater resistance, and since 1945 is the company Jose Diaz is in charge of its manufacturing and commercialization.

At present the City
Council seeks to promote the drink as a symbol of the city in order to exploit it as a typical item for tourists, for which information campaigns are conducted within the local businesses.
